Despite lacking a ticket office, South Ruislip Station is equipped with ticket machines, providing passengers the convenience of collecting pre-purchased tickets. For those who need assistance, staff are present on weekdays and Saturdays from 6:50 AM till 11:30 AM, while they offer extended hours till 2:00 PM on Sundays. If you require help outside of these times, the station has customer help points available.
Accessibility at the station can be limited. Although the station has ticket barriers, it lacks step-free access, meaning passengers who require assistance should plan accordingly. Induction loops are available, enhancing convenience for passengers with hearing aids, but there are no ramps, accessible toilets, or waiting rooms.
Refreshing yourself with a coffee isn't an issue, thanks to the presence of a handy coffee kiosk. However, facilities such as public Wi-Fi, payphones, and ATMs are not available on-site, so it's wise to prepare before you arrive.
One of South Ruislip Station's highlights is its connectivity via various modes of transport. The station is served by the Central Line of the London Underground, providing swift access to central London and beyond. For local commutes, bus number 114 stops nearby on Victoria Road, ensuring easy transitions from train to local travel.
Additionally, if your rail services are disrupted, the rail replacement buses offer an alternative, with stops conveniently located near the station's shopping parade.

Lewes Train Station is well-equipped with facilities to ensure your journey starts smoothly. The ticket office operates daily with hours tailored to accommodate travelers: weekdays from 06:30 until 20:45, Saturdays until 20:20, and Sundays from 07:30 until 19:15. For added convenience, ticket machines are available for both standard and accessible use,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ets with ease.
In terms of accessibility, the station offers some step-free access, with Category B2 designation due to steep ramps and lifts to other platforms. Assistance is readily available from the ticket office, and staff help can be arranged upon request. Enhanced safety measures such as CCTV and help points are also in place, offering peace of mind while you navigate the station. Although there's no waiting room office, you can find seating areas to relax while awaiting your train.
Whether you're exploring Lewes itself or venturing further afield, the station's transport links make travel convenient. A taxi rank located just outside the main entrance offers hassle-free onward journeys. While the station does not provide cycle hire facilities, it does have ample bicycle storage, accommodating up to 236 bikes, ensuring ample space for cyclists commuting or exploring the surrounding areas.
